GMS FRETA, Mekong Institute and GIZ organized national seminar on “Green Freight: Enhancing Transport and Logistics Business Performance in Myanmar” at UMFCCI, Yangon, Myanmar on 20 January 2017.
The seminar aims to raise awareness of private company in trucking and logistics sector to improve their business performance by implementing Green Freight measures. It was honored by Mr. Lian Cin Mang, Director of Road Transport Administration Department, Ministry of Transport and Communication (MOTC) and Ms. Delphine BRISSONNEAU, EU Delegation to Myanmar to give the welcome remarks.
Attended by approximately 80 participants, the seminar took up several issues such as environmental challenges for freight transport, Green Freight’s definition, government role in promoting Green Freight, Green Freight options/measures, increasing fuel efficiency of road freight, benefit of Green Freight and Logistics as well as good practices around this region. Moreover, it received good support from Thai Department of Land Transport in sharing the knowledge and experiences on Q Mark labelling for trucking services.
